Ancient Nutra Katupila capsules contain pure Katupila powder sourced from small-scale Sri Lankan farmers. Known in Ayurveda as Sharapunkha, Katupila grows in the dry zones and sandy coasts of Sri Lanka and India, and is a prized traditional herb.

What is Katupila also known as?
In Ayurveda it is known as Sharapunkha, a herb traditionally grown in the dry zones and sandy coasts of Sri Lanka and India.
How is it traditionally used?
Traditionally for detox, urinary support, and skin health, as part of a daily wellness routine.
